list of books i read over the summer bc goodreads is banned on this computer :(((((
The First to Die at the End: 20/10 SOBBED MULTIPLE TIMES THIS BOOK KILLED ME
Nimona: 20/10 the comfort book for when book above made me sob
Neanderthal Opens a Door to the Universe: 15:10 holy s--- man i was not prepared for such a smack in the face of a book the author for this is a master of writing teenagers because all of the characters were so realistic and that was exactly what gave it the extra punch of phenominalness
Simon Verses the Homosapiens Agenda: 6/10 idk man i expected it to be so much MORE since A) i heard so much about it and B) it's an incredibly banned book which i assumed made it AWESOME, but it was just kinda meh. There's nothing objectively wrong with it, it's a cute queer story and an easy read, but it felt a bit too tame and easy for the extraordinary fanbase it had. I expected it to hit me like Neanderthal did, which is funny since i read this BEFORE i read that book lmao
Voyage of the Dawn Treader: 9/10 its as amazing as i remembered C.S. Lewis is a legend of an author for a reason
Ace of Spades: 20/10 it got me out of my readers slump and O M G i cannot believe this book nor can i believe the person who let me borrow it actually read it because it is INSANITY. A racist cult Gossip Girls type school is one of the most gut wrenching, insanity roller coaster plot of a story i have ever had the honor of reading and i could not be happier it exists. I'm SHOCKED it's not one of the most banned books in the country because of how incredibly awesome and eye opening it is
Celestial Monsters: 100/10 the first book in the series, Sunbearer Trials, is one of my favorite books in existense, and the sequel did NOT disappoint. It has the same humor, fast pacedness, well writteness, and creative uses of mythology that Percy Jackson has, yet it doesn't feel like a knockoff, rather like a passion project, and had the same level of refreshing enjoyment. You can truly tell how much the author cared about EVERYTHING, from characters to pacing to romance to even the very setting and environments they're in. Everything feels very intentional, and nothing is out of place. The series is truly one of my favorites, second only to the wonderful legend of Rick Riordans' work himself
